Transaction 59e6c16ab4801f3ae2a6dde777aceb3aa6ef14224fafb4b49624edba34607f8b
1 Input
1 Output
-
59e6c16ab4801f3ae2a6dde777aceb3aa6ef14224fafb4b49624edba34607f8b:0
- value
- 12007880
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8f7969fcd3e6fe06ced42b818846e9f86e90c1e2 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1E5d5RfrNpEdAZck9BPLxQDPa2R22n2pQj